这两年,看到了太多人把比特币和区块链技术混为一谈了,我作为一个区块链技术的非专业人士也很清楚,技术是技术,产物是产物,编程是技术,游戏是产物,但是你不能看见我碰电脑就说我玩游戏吧(就到现在我妈看见我码字还是叫我少打游戏,我招谁惹谁了)。
当我们把比特币和区块链混一谈的时候就成了骗子频发的圈子了,我相信很多人都遇到过打着国家大力推动区块链技术发展的幌子兜售没听过名字的虚拟币(这玩意和我打游戏的金币有啥区别,想发多少发多少)。
比特币其实在区块链技术的使用上主要是两点,一个是比特币的发行机制,还有一个是比特币的交易机制。
比特币的发行机制相信大家都有所了解了,简单的说就是挖矿,具体地说呢,就是一个去中心化的发行机制,比特币系统相当于一个去中心化的大账本,而“挖矿”就是计算其中某个区块,我们可以理解为获得大账本中一页的记账权。
当然了,我们费了那么多的电费获得了记账权,是不是要给我奖励啊,没错,系统会生成比特币来作为矿工记账奖励(现在挖矿都是加入挖矿队伍,来提高团队算力,从而加大获得记账权的可能,家里的电脑就别想搞这个了,一天下来吃不上四菜一汤)。
举个简单的例子就是比特币系统每10分钟会出一道计算题,首先算出答案就能获得本页记账权,从而获得比特币奖励。21万题,每题奖励50个比特币,21-42万题奖励25个,以此类推,等到奖励不足0.00000001(应该没记错,小数点后八位,如果错了麻烦和我说下)就结束了。大概也就到2140年吧,就没了。
所以没有一个人能完整地拥有一个大账本,这个账本被拆成了很多页,分散在世界各地,这就是第一个区块链技术的表现,去中心化。
第二个就是比特币的转账了,传统银行转账都是银行负责记账,所以大账本就在银行手上,银行就是中心。而比特币转账时比特币地址对比特币地址的转账,并且全网公布,相当于所有人都知道了这笔交易,全网矿工将这笔交易记录进当前区块,通常6次以上的交易确认就无法修改了(当然量子计算机这种变态的东西出现就相当于降为打击了,不过应该不会出现,哪怕某些国家已经研发成功,也是用于科研,而不是来比特币市场大材小用)。
交易的全网公布是另一个去中心化的体现,顺便和大家交流下比特币的转账流程吧,一般通过比特币交易平台,比特币钱包或者客户端,填写的内容就是自己的地址,对方的地址,转账金额和手续费金额(这玩意就是小费,不然谁给你记账啊)。有些朋友可能想说自己在某些交易平台上根本没有这么麻烦,那我只能建议你看看自己口袋,比特币在你口袋里吗?